Romaero Bucharest (RORX.RO), a strategic company for the Romanian aerospace and defense industry, ended the first half of 2022 with RON26.8 million net loss, up from the RON22.5 million loss in the year-ago period. Revenue increased by 113.2% to RON40.4 million, according to ZF’s calculations based on data from the Bucharest Stock Exchange.

New car registrations in Romania increased by 33.38% to a total 11,927 units in September 2022 versus September 2021, data from the association of automotive manufacturers in Romania (ACAROM) and of Romania’s General Directorate for Driving Licenses and Car Registration (DRPCIV) showed on Monday (Oct 3).

OMV Petrom, the largest integrated energy company in Southeast Europe, will build, in partnership with Complexul Energetic Oltenia (CE Oltenia), four photovoltaic (PV) parks with a total power capacity of ~450 MW, with investments set to top EUR400 million.
